Commercial Information Circular No. 91/2009

Australia : Restrictions on Imported Manufactured Goods Containing Asbestos

The Australian Customs has recently detected a number of goods containing asbestos in imported manufactured goods. It is reminded that the importation of asbestos or goods containing asbestos into Australia is generally prohibited under the "Customs (Prohibited Imports) Regulations 1956 (Customs PI Regulations)". Importers of asbestos or goods containing asbestos into Australia without prior permission can face a fine of up to AUD110,000. A copy of the fact sheet on importing asbestos into Australia is attached at Annex (pdf format) for reference.
